**The Innovation Teacher: Why Don't Students Take Intellectual Risks?**

When grading culture punishes experimentation, students learn to play it safe—but what if we could transform our classrooms into spaces where intellectual risks are rewarded instead of penalized? Join Dr. Greg Watson, The Innovation Professor Who Actually Teaches, as he reveals how innovation pedagogy creates the psychological safety students need to embrace creativity, curiosity, and discovery across every discipline. Discover practical strategies that will empower your students to think boldly, fail forward, and unlock their true learning potential.
